Creswell train station, located in Derbyshire, England, operates along the Robin Hood Line and offers convenient access to a variety of destinations. Whether you're commuting for work or exploring the region's heritage and nature, this article provides all the essential information you need to travel confidently from Creswell train station.
Creswell Station is a quaint yet functional railway station, where you can collect ticket purchases conveniently using the available ticket machines. While there is no formal ticket office, the machines also support online bookings, and smartcard validators are present for added convenience. For those requiring support, help points are available, ensuring assistance when needed.
Although Creswell Station is modest in its offerings, it is equipped with essential accessibility features, including step-free access across platforms via ramps, tactile paving, and induction loops. However, travelers should note the lack of direct platform access, requiring a brief walk via Elmton Road to transfer platforms.
When it comes to onward travel, Creswell Station links seamlessly with other transport modes, helping you reach your next destination quickly. Rail replacement services set off from Elmton Road and local bus information is readily accessible for planning your journey. Although there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ities, bicycle storage is available at the station for those looking to explore the area on two wheels.

Situated in Merseyside, England, Newton-le-Willows train station offers a convenient hub for travelers wishing to explore both local and national destinations. Whether you're a commuter or a tourist, the station provides a gateway to many alluring places worth visiting. Known for its strategic location between key cities, it has become a favored choice for those looking to access efficient rail services across the UK.
At Newton-le-Willows train station, you will find a ticket office that operates extensive hours, opening as early as 6 a.m. and closing just before midnight. There are also user-friendly ticket machines that accommodate both cash and card payments, ensuring a smooth ticket purchasing experience. The station caters to the needs of all travelers with smartcard validators and an induction loop.
For those needing assistance, staff help is available, and customer help points are strategically placed around the station. Though there is no luggage storage option, CCTV cameras are present for enhanced security. Accessibility features include step-free access throughout the station, a scooter-friendly environment, and ramps for train access. However, facilities such as waiting rooms and seating areas are not available. Additionally, there are 32 dedicated accessible parking spaces within the 400-space car park operated by Merseytravel, offering free parking.
Conveniently, the station is linked with various transportation modes. There's a handy bus interchange outside the station's booking office on Alfred Street for those needing to catch a rail replacement service or general bus services. For a more personalized trip, taxis can be booked online at Cab4You. Although bicycle hire is not offered, the facilities are supportive of cycling enthusiasts, providing 24 sheltered bike storage spaces equipped with CCTV surveillance.
